Food and Dining
The Dining Room
We had a table of six, and rarely over an hour for all of us to eat, which I thought was pretty reasonable. Nice selection of food. And on the 35 day cruise, I believe we had lobster included on the menu three times.
Dive-In
The burgers were very good. They were not greasy at all, and they were nice and thick. The hotdogs were very similar to Costco hotdogs very good. And I had a chicken sandwich and I thought it was very tasty.

Onboard Activities
Sea View Pool
Hot tubs were consistently about 102°, sometimes warmer. The pool generally was between 85 and 90. Only had an issue one time at the pool got dirty/cloudy and I mentioned it to a staff member that I hadn’t swam in it in two days because I didn’t feel comfortable swimming in water like that. By the next morning, it was crystal clear she was taking care of very quickly.

Ship tip
Try to take advantage of all the different music venues provided on the ship they’re quite enjoyable. They have a nice gym. The hot tubs are usually 102° so they’re nice. The pool at the aft is heated usually warmer than the midship pool.
